    It's missing ambient shading, and little details. A lot of TCW used more detailing on the characters from S3 onwards, and we became used to it. Characters got progressively scruffy and dirty, the environments became more three dimensional, the characters felt more like flesh and blood characters. They moved smoother, and their designs felt more alive.

    For comparison, TCW S5 and SW:R S1:
    [​IMG]
    [​IMG]
    Rebels doesn't have any of that. It looks computer generated. The characters look wooden again, like they did in the first two seasons of TCW. They don't move naturally anymore, the environments look faker. The street and metal on the side of the transport in the SW:R image, for example, looks like a cut and paste texture. The textures in TCW felt more tangible, while in SW: R they don't feel tangible or detailed whatsoever.
